In the arithmetic-logic unit (which is within … WebMar 7, 2024 · To open a file in binary mode you must add the letter b to the end of the mode string; for example, “wb”. For the read and write modes, you can add the b, either after the plus sign – “r+b” – or before – “rb+”. The file is extended if the put pointer is currently at the end of the file. If this pointer points into the middle ...

WebJul 30, 2024 · To write a binary file in C++ use write method. It is used to write a given number of bytes on the given stream, starting at the position of the "put" pointer. The file is extended if the put pointer is current at the end of the file. If this pointer points into the middle of the file, characters in the file are overwritten with the new data.
